Tell whether each function is linear or non-linear. Function A Function B x 0 1 2 3 y 0 1 8 27 y = –x + 5

Step-by-step explanation:

The slope-intercept form of the linear function  

[tex]y = mx+b[/tex]

where

  • m is the slope
  • b is the y-intercept

The graph of y = mx + b is a straight line. Thus, y = mx + b represents a linear function.

Analzing the function y = –x + 5

Given the linear function

y = –x + 5

comparing with the slope-intercept form of linear equation

The slope m = -1

The y-intercept b = 5

Also, the graph of a linear function is a straight line.

Thus,

The function  y = –x + 5 represents  a linear function.

Analzing the Table Function

x        0     1     2     3

y        0     1     8     27

In order to identify whether the given table represents the linear function or not, we need to make sure the given function has a constant change x and y.

If there is a constant change in x and y, then it would be a linear Function otherwise it would not represent a linear function.

There is a constant change in x values.

i.e.

1 - 0 = 1

2 - 1 = 1

3 - 2 = 1

But, there is NOT a constant change in y.

i.e.

1 - 0 = 0

8 - 1 = 7

27 - 8 = 19

It is clear that the table does not have a constant change in y-values.

Therefore, the table function does not represent the linear function
